About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ml

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ml is an oral prescription medicine used to relieve dry, unproductive coughs and upper respiratory allergy symptoms like sneezing, runny nose, and itchy eyes. It combines a cough suppressant with an antihistamine to target both the cough reflex and allergic triggers. Doctors typically prescribe it for temporary relief from symptoms caused by the common cold, flu, or respiratory allergies.

To get the best results, take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ml consistently at the times prescribed by your doctor to maintain steady levels in your body. You can take this oral liquid with or without food, though taking it with a meal or a glass of milk can help prevent stomach upset. Drinking plenty of water throughout the day can also help thin mucus in your airways, making breathing easier.

While taking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ml, you may experience mild side effects such as drowsiness, dry mouth, or mild constipation. These issues are usually temporary and manageable, but you must contact your doctor immediately if you notice serious symptoms like extreme sleepiness, shallow breathing, or confusion.

Before starting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ml, talk to your doctor if you have a history of asthma, thyroid disease, high blood pressure, liver problems, or difficulty urinating. Do not take this medicine if you have severe breathing difficulties, a bowel blockage, or if you have taken certain depression medications in the past two weeks.

Avoid drinking alcohol and smoking while taking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ml, as alcohol can dangerously increase drowsiness, and smoking further irritates sensitive airways. Tell your doctor if you take other medications, such as sleep aids or muscle relaxants, as they can cause severe sedation when combined with this syrup. Pregnant women, breastfeeding mothers, and elderly individuals should always consult their doctor before using this medicine to ensure it is safe for their specific needs.

How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ml Works

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ml is a combination medicine containing two active ingredients that work in different ways to relieve your symptoms. The first active ingredient, codeine, is an antitussive, or cough suppressant. It acts directly on the cough centre in your brain to temporarily turn down the cough reflex. This helps reduce the constant tickle in your throat and limits dry, hacking coughing spells. The second active ingredient, triprolidine, is an antihistamine. When your body is exposed to allergens or viral infections, it releases a natural chemical called histamine, which causes swelling, itching, and fluid production in your nose and eyes. The antihistamine blocks these histamine signals, which dries up nasal passages, stops sneezing, and calms itchy, watery eyes. Working together, these two ingredients soothe your airways and ease congestion simultaneously.

What if I have taken an overdose of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ml

If you suspect an overdose, seek emergency medical help immediately. Symptoms of an overdose can include extreme sleepiness, very slow or shallow breathing, pinpoint pupils, cold and clammy skin, or a dangerously slow heartbeat.

Drug-Drug Interactions

verifiedApollotooltip
  • Medicines that cause drowsiness (e.g., sleeping pills, opioid pain relievers, muscle relaxants, or anti-anxiety medicines): Taking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ml together with other central nervous system (CNS) depressants may cause excessive drowsiness, dizziness, impaired coordination, slowed breathing, and, in severe cases, life-threatening respiratory depression. Your doctor may recommend avoiding these combinations or monitoring you closely.
  • Monoamine oxidase inhibitors (MAOIs): Do not take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ml if you are currently taking, or have taken within the past 14 days, an MAOI. Combining these medicines can cause serious, potentially life-threatening reactions. Tell your doctor if you have recently used an MAOI before starting treatment.

FAQs

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ml is used to treat dry cough associated with a common cold or upper respiratory allergies.
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ml is a combination of two drugs: Triprolidine and Codeine, which relieves dry cough. Triprolidine is an antihistaminic that blocks a chemical messenger (histamine) that may trigger a cough due to an allergy. Codeine is a cough suppressant. It suppresses cough by reducing the activity of the cough centre in the brain.
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ml is excreted in breast milk and may cause drowsiness, breathing problems, or death in a nursing baby. Therefore, if you are breastfeeding, please inform your doctor before taking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ml. Your doctor will weigh the benefits and any potential risks before prescribing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ml to you.
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ml is not recommended for children below 18 years of age as a misuse of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ml in children may lead to serious adverse effects. Codeine in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ml may cause life-threatening respiratory depression and death in children who recently had surgery to remove the tonsils or adenoids.
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ml may be used to provide relief from allergic symptoms such as sneezing, runny nose, throat irritation, or watery eyes.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ml contains Triprolidine, an anti-allergic drug that works by blocking the action of histamine, a substance responsible for causing allergic reactions.
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ml is unsafe to use in pregnancy.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ml contains Triprolidine, If you use Codicon-T Cough Syrup 100 ml while pregnant, your baby could become dependent on codeine. This can cause life-threatening withdrawal symptoms in the baby after it is born.
